Chinese company Dongfeng Motor is developing Warrior — a new version of the large SUV, which externally resembles a classic military all-terrain vehicle HMMWV (the "civilian" model is known as Hummer H1). The basis of Warrior M18 is a new platform, developed by Dongfeng specifically for large electric vehicles. The SUV will get a power plant with a total capacity of 800 kW, which is equivalent to 1,087 horsepower.The heavy 5.2-meter car weighing 3.1 tons will be able to accelerate from a standing start to a hundred in about 5 seconds. A set of 140 kWh batteries will allow traveling at least 500 kilometers on a single charge. At the same time, it will be possible to recharge the battery with the special system in less than 30 minutes.
In addition, the Warrior M18 will get a complex of modern semi-automatic control systems. As expected, the model will have adaptive cruise control, lane-holding function, automatic emergency braking system, and other active electronic "assistants".
Warrior will be able to compete with the new GMC Hummer EV, which is equipped with three electric motors with a total output of more than 1,000 horsepower in its "senior" modification. The batteries allow driving about 550 kilometers without recharging. Production of the electric SUV will begin in 2023. Prices for cars will start from about 700 thousand yuan (about $110 000).
